    Military training was almost over.

    That evening, during rest time, Lin Zheng Ran headed back to the dormitory as usual, parting from the Three Little Ones.

    In the future, he’d definitely move out with those three little guys, so he wasn’t sure how many more days he’d spend in the boys’ dormitory.

    Lately, he could start looking into finding a place to live, and there were Wen Wen’s live streaming competition and Lily’s music contest, both happening later this year.

    Lin Zheng Ran pushed open the dormitory door, thinking his roommates wouldn’t bother with him—after all, during military training, he’d become public enemy number one among the guys.

    But to his surprise, the once spacious four-person dorm was now crammed full of people.

    Glancing around, he saw at least twenty or thirty guys packed in, all chattering away.

    “When’s he getting here?”

    “No idea, but he should be soon.”

    “Yeah, probably on his way.”

    When they spotted Lin Zheng Ran walking in, he blinked in confusion. “So many people?”

    Their eyes widened in shock.

    Suddenly, everyone lined up neatly in the dorm and bowed in unison:

    “Father! Teach us how to win over beautiful girlfriends and make the girls we like fall for us! Please, Father! We’ll buy your meals, fetch your water for the next few years—you won’t have to lift a finger. Just show us the way, Father!!!”

    They all bowed deeply: “Father!!”

    Their voices boomed in perfect harmony, strong and full of energy!

    Once Lin Zheng Ran caught on, he marveled at how only top students truly understand that the most abstract things in the world often come from fellow scholars.

    University was nothing like high school.

    In high school, everyone was buried in studies, and they really ignored him because they had no time, but in university… extremes had flipped.

    So, a few minutes later, Lin Zheng Ran sat on his bed.

    Two guys on either side massaged his back with grins. “Comfortable, Father? How’s the pressure?”

    Another brought over a basin of foot-washing water. “Father, test the temperature. I’ll add some rose petals later.”

    Someone else held up a stack of instant noodles, smiling wide. “Father, what flavor for your midnight snack? I recommend the shrimp and fish cake one—it’s my favorite.”

    Sweat beaded on Lin Zheng Ran’s forehead, and instantly, someone wiped it away with a towel, yelling in panic, “Quick, turn on the AC! Father’s sweating!”

    A group scrambled for the remote. “I’ll do it! Let me!”

    One guy even climbed up to the AC unit to adjust it manually. “Back off, I’ll handle the temperature!”

    Lin Zheng Ran paused. “Look, what are you all really after? What do you want to ask me?”

    They all gasped and crowded around, faces full of devotion, like meeting a living saint.

    “Father, we just want to know how you managed to attract all the campus beauties in our freshman class. We’ve spent years just being good at studies, with no other advantages, and we’ve never even had a girlfriend from childhood.”

    One guy was crying, wiping tears:

    “Forget girlfriends—I accidentally touched a girl’s black, silky hair when I was fifteen, and I didn’t wash my hands for a week! It was so soft, with a faint shampoo scent. I still dream about it.”

    “Me too! In high school, a girl bumped into my arms during a scuffle, and for that whole month, I felt like I was floating. My studying even doubled in speed.”

    “Same here! I’ve never had a girl like me growing up. They call me a bookworm, always buried in books, but it’s not true!

    I was just too shy to talk to them, so I acted like a top student to hide how awkward I am. That’s how I ended up here. Boo-hoo.”

    Another bespectacled scholar pulled out a cherished talisman from his pocket and said seriously:

    “This has the sugarcane bits chewed by a girl I once liked. I’ve kept it as my lucky charm all these years—it’s helped me ace every exam. Even though she has a boyfriend now,

    I know my feelings weren’t just for her; it’s for that invisible youth, that ideal first love. I want a real girlfriend too!”

    Everyone shared their heartbreaking stories.

    One said to Lin Zheng Ran, “So, Father, during military training, we saw how girls flock to you every day, bringing water, snacks, even getting jealous for you. What a life to envy!”

    Another clutched his chest. “Seeing that shocked us to our core! We’ve never even imagined such things.

    If a girl did that for us in real life, like bringing water with her lipstick on it, I’d eat braised beef instant noodles for a month straight and give up my favorite shrimp and fish cake flavor without a second thought!”

    “Father, we’re begging you—teach us a few tricks, even just one or two. From now on, we’ll support everything you do in this school! You’re our idol, our god!”

    They all raised their hands, gazing at Lin Zheng Ran. “Lin Zheng Ran, our god! May you guide us!”

    Lin Zheng Ran cleared his throat. “This feels like some cult ritual. I mean, no one even talked to me during training.”

    Everyone fell silent.

    Then they quickly defended themselves:

    “That’s because we were so jealous of you back then that it clouded our minds. But after cooling down, we realized the only way to find light is to follow your path!

    As the saying goes, follow the good and change the bad!

    We’ve come to our senses. Facing the ultimate scholar and romance king like you, our god, we should draw close, not ignore you! We’re sorry for the past few days; we regret it! We feel guilty!”

    Lin Zheng Ran waved his hand. “Alright, alright, I get it. Hold on, let me soak my feet first and think about what to say.”

    A guy checked the water temperature with his hand and shouted in alarm, “It’s dropped two degrees! Heat it up quick—Father’s sacred feet deserve the perfect warmth!”

    Lin Zheng Ran chuckled, and that night, he pondered briefly. Since they were so sincere, he shared a few simple tips with them.

    Truth be told, when it comes to dating, nothing else matters—it’s all about one thing: courage.

    With courage, anyone can find love.

    Even though Lin Zheng Ran didn’t say much, they all scribbled notes in their little notebooks, utterly amazed.

    Before bed, as they left, they bowed to Lin Zheng Ran one by one, in perfect sync: “Oh great one, may you have sweet dreams tonight. Lin Gate~”

    Lin Zheng Ran: “.”

    What a bunch of oddballs.
